What will you do?

Discover the authentic heart of Salento in a day full of excitement, history, and flavors. From the Baroque elegance of Galatina, with its frescoed churches and timeless atmosphere, to the vibrant beauty of Gallipoli, overlooking a crystal-clear sea, to the unique charm of Otranto, Italy's easternmost city, where the Adriatic meets legend.

This full-day tour is the perfect introduction to the jewels of the South, including charming villages, breathtaking views, and living traditions.

During the morning, there will be a delicious brunch break in Galatina featuring the most iconic specialties of Salento pastries: warm pasticciotto and rustic Lecce pastries, accompanied by a drink included, to start the day with an authentic taste of the region.

A complete experience combining culture, sea, and taste, designed for those who want to experience Salento in an intense and unforgettable way.

Galatina

Explore Galatina with its frescoed Baroque churches, historic buildings, and authentic streets in the heart of Salento.

Gallipoli

Explore Gallipoli with its historic center by the sea, picturesque alleys, and breathtaking views of the crystal-clear waters.

Otranto

Explore Otranto with its ancient walls, the charm of the seaside village, and its unique atmosphere between the Adriatic Sea and history.

We offer pickups from Lecce (8:30 a.m. at Piazza Sant'Oronzo) and Brindisi 9:00 a.m. at Piazza Cairoli). Hotel pickups are available upon request. Please arrive 10 minutes before departure. Your driver will contact you via WhatsApp to facilitate the meeting.

Our guide is a native Italian speaker, but will speak in English during the tour. We also provide audio guides in 6 languages (Italian, English, French, German, Spanish, and Polish) so you can enjoy detailed commentary in your preferred language.

Of course! Menus can be tailored to your needs: vegetarian, vegan, gluten-free, or any allergies. Our tour leader will ask you directly about your requirements.

This tour involves moderate walking (2-3 hours total) on cobblestone streets and some stairs. It is not wheelchair accessible due to the historic nature of the villages. We recommend comfortable walking shoes. If you have any concerns about mobility, please contact us before booking.

We recommend bringing comfortable walking shoes, sunscreen, a hat, water, and a camera. In summer, light clothing is ideal. In cooler months, bring a light jacket. Cash is useful for personal purchases and optional tips.
